
Senior Software Engineer - Frontend
Hybrid
London, United Kingdom
Full Time
31-03-2025
Job Specifications
Whitbread, the owner of Premier Inn and some of the UK’s favourite restaurants,processes nearly £2 billion in transactions each year and employs around 40,000 people. As the new ...
Whitbread, the owner of Premier Inn and some of the UK’s favourite restaurants,
processes nearly £2 billion in transactions each year and employs around 40,000 people.
As the new Senior Software Engineer, you will work as part of our Premier Inn digital team to solve real-world problems at scale, building REST API’s using a Microservices architecture. You will drive innovation, monitor system health, resolve performance issues, and optimize technology investments. By leveraging technical expertise, collaboration, and emerging technologies that deliver high-quality solutions that align with strategic goals and enable business success.
Role: Senior Software Engineer - Frontend
Package: £85,000 + 30% company performance bonus, plus car or car cash allowance of £5,651.00pa
Contract Type: Full-Time and Permanent
Location: Holborn, London and a hybrid way of working with a minimum of 3 days a week in the office.
Why You’ll Love It Here
Healthcare: Individual & Family BUPA healthcare
Bonus: Up to 30% of annual salary
10% matched pension
Discounts: Up to 60% discount on Premier Inn stays and 25% discount on our Restaurant brand
Check out all our benefits here: https://www.whitbreadcareers.com/about-us/benefits/
What You’ll Be Doing
As the Senior Software Engineer – Frontend, you will lead on the design, development, testing, deployment, and maintenance platforms, products, and services, to ensure systems are reliable, high performing, and continuously improved to meet evolving business needs.
You will drive innovation, monitor system health, resolve performance issues, and optimize technology investments. By leveraging technical expertise, collaboration, and emerging technologies that deliver high-quality solutions that align with strategic goals and enable business success.
What You’ll Need
Expert in JavaScript/Typescript, Next JS, React or Angular. Writes clean, efficient, maintainable code, AB testing and Versioning. Drive continuous improvements. Understanding of Devops tools, CICD pipelines and cloud tech stacks (like K8s). Understand on third party integrations.
Responsive design: strong UI/UX knowledge, implements designs, ensures accessibility. Proficient in CSS, Have good experience in CSS libraries like Tailwind etc. Good expertise in Unit testing and automation testing libraries.
Performance optimisation and debugging skilled in debugging, profiling, and optimising frontend performance reducing re-renders, lazy loading, Caching strategy, fix memory leak, state managements etc.) Ability to mentor and coach.
Be part of our Technology Team at Whitbread
Through collaboration, passion and hiring the smartest minds, our Technology team builds products and services that are used by 38,000 of us at Whitbread and millions of guests. Everything from an eCommerce website that handles £2 billion in transactions per year, applications that are scalable across our 1,200 hotel and restaurants, devices that enable our teams and guests to have a seamless experience, all whilst keeping data secure. Together we’re building the hotel of the future.
We believe that everyone is unique and there should be no barriers to entry and no limits to ambition. We are committed to being an inclusive organisation that values diversity and welcomes your application whatever your background or situation.
Under-represented groups such as women, ethnic minorities, people with disabilities & members of the LGBTQIA+ community (those who identify as lesbian, gay, bi, trans and non-binary or those who use a different LGBTQIA+ term), are strongly encouraged to build a career with us. Speak to us about workplace adjustments, part-time and flexible working. Where possible we will support this.
Job ref: 58386-4492
Advertised: 31 Mar 2025
About the Company
Whitbread PLC is the owner of the UK’s favourite hotel chain, Premier Inn, as well as restaurant brands, Beefeater, Brewers Fayre, Table Table, Bar + Block and Cookhouse and Pub. Whitbread employs more than 35,000 people in more than 1,200 Premier Inn hotels and restaurants across the UK and Germany, serving over five million customers every month. At Whitbread we are committed to being a force for good in the communities in which we operate. Our Sustainability programme, ‘Force for Good’ is focused on enabling people to ... Know more
Related Jobs


- Company Name
- Coforge U.K. Ltd
- Job Title
- Salesforce Developer
- Job Description
- Role: Salesforce Developer (Service cloud) Location: London (Hybrid) Type: Permanent Salary: GBP 70k per annum Salesforce Cloud Expertise: Service Cloud Experience Cloud Salesforce Development Skills: Lightning Web Components (LWC). Apex (Triggers, Batch, Asynchronous Processing). Salesforce Flow & native automation tools. Integrations & Security: Salesforce Integrations (REST/SOAP API, Platform Events, External Services). Integration with Third-Party Services (API integration, Middleware e.g., MuleSoft). OAuth 2.0/JWT Authentication. Secure API Development. Data & Performance Optimization: Large Data Volume (LDV) Handling. Governor Limits Optimization. DevOps Skills: Salesforce DX (SFDX) Git-Based Version Control (Bitbucket) CI/CD for Salesforce Nice to Have: Experience with Accessibility requirements and development (e.g., WCAG 2.2), Experience with Salesforce Public Sector Solutions, Experience Service Cloud. Coforge is an equal opportunities employer and welcomes applications from all sections of society and does not discriminate on grounds of race, religion or belief, ethnic or national origin, disability, age, citizenship, marital, domestic or civil partnership status, sexual orientation, or gender identity, or any other basis as protected by applicable law.


- Company Name
- Perch Group
- Job Title
- Software Engineer
- Job Description
- Perch Group are searching for a Software Engineer. At Perch Group, our vision is clear: to lead the UK debt purchase and collection industry by harnessing cutting-edge technology to drive ethical, efficient, and data-driven debt resolution. Our annual mission is to empower hundreds of thousands of customers to positively engage with and resolve their outstanding debts. We do this through an empathetic and customer-centric approach that is at the heart of our success. £50,000 + up to 20% of your annual salary, paid as a bonus. This role is based at our Blackpool or Manchester Spinningfields office, with occasional travel to our Skipton office. We offer hybrid working options. About Our Team Perch Group houses data-driven services spanning the entire debt lifecycle, including BPO services, debt collection, debt purchase, reconnection, and litigation services. Working in the Data and MI team, we are looking for a mid-level software engineer with good technical skills who has a general understanding of software development principles. The daily tasks would involve enhancing current functionality while also developing fresh features and integrating them with both internal services and external applications. You'll make a major contribution by… Working closely with senior software engineers, analysts, and project managers to ensure that projects are completed on time and to a high standard. Developing new product features on the company platforms as per specification. Troubleshooting and resolving platform issues and bugs with precision and efficiency. Participating in code reviews. Contributing to specifications. Working and collaborating with product team members. Producing quality code with a low defect count. You should apply for this role if you have… Knowledge Knowledge of a Software programming lifecycle (SDLC). Responsive UI design. Knowledge of source control like Git and Azure DevOps. Github and code repository controls. Public Cloud platforms (AWS, Azure or GCP) and containerization tools. Skills C# Design Patterns. Tools and process to resolve complex issues. Microsoft SQL Strong SQL coding and structured/nonstructured data concepts. Behaviours Passion for programming and embracing new technology. Passion for solving client challenges and commitment to client experience. A growth mindset and proven desire for continuous learning and improvement. Confident communicator, who can articulate problems and solutions just as clearly to the executive team as to engineering teams. The Application Timeline A first stage video call with the internal recruitment team (15 minute call) A face to face or video call with the hiring manager (45 minutes- 60 minutes) Typically, the average successful applicant will be within this timeline for 2-3 weeks. Please note we will close this role once we have enough applications for the next stages therefore you should submit your application asap to avoid any disappointment. If you do not receive a response after 3 weeks of applying, please assume you have been unsuccessful as we may experience a high volume of applications. If you have any questions or suggestions of how we can assist you in your application due to disability or personal reasons, please email recruitment@perchgroup.co.uk. What’s In It For You £50,000 + up to 20% of your annual salary, paid as a bonus. This role is based at our Blackpool or Manchester Spinningfields office, with occasional travel to our Skipton office. We offer hybrid working options. ⏰ 37.5 hours per week. We offer flexible working hours between our core hours of 8am- 6pm, Monday to Friday. The opportunity to complete formal qualifications and learn on the job in a successful, growing organisation. And many more benefits to support your wellbeing and professional development. We are an equal opportunities employer We’re an equal opportunity employer. All applicants will be considered for employment without attention to age, ethnicity, religion, sex, sexual orientation, gender identity, family or parental status, national origin, or veteran, neurodiversity or disability status. At Perch, our strength lies in our team, their enthusiasm, and their passion for the business. Whether you’re looking to gain foundational skills in financial services, have a knack for customer service, or seek to expand your horizons, we likely have the perfect opportunity for you.


- Company Name
- Outlier
- Job Title
- Web Developer
- Job Description
- Outlier helps the world’s most innovative companies improve their AI models by providing human feedback. Are you an experienced software engineer who would like to lend your coding expertise to train AI models? We partner with organizations to train AI large language models, helping cutting-edge generative AI models write better code. Projects typically include discrete, highly variable problems that involve engaging with these models as they learn to code. There is no requirement for previous AI experience. About The Opportunity Outlier is looking for talented coders to help train generative artificial intelligence models This freelance opportunity is remote and hours are flexible, so you can work whenever is best for you You may contribute your expertise by… Crafting and answering questions related to computer science in order to help train AI models Evaluating and ranking code generated by AI models Examples Of Desirable Expertise Currently enrolled in or completed a bachelor's degree or higher in computer science at a selective institution Proficiency working with one or more of the the following languages: Java, Python, JavaScript / TypeScript, C++, Swift, and Verilog Excellent attention to detail, including grammar, punctuation, and style guidelines Payment Currently, pay rates for core project work by coding experts range from USD $12.50 to $50 per hour. Rates vary based on expertise, skills assessment, location, project need, and other factors. For example, higher rates may be offered to PhDs. For non-core work, such as during initial project onboarding or project overtime phases, lower rates may apply. Certain projects offer incentive payments. Please review the payment terms for each project.


- Company Name
- Outlier
- Job Title
- Full Stack Developer
- Job Description
- Outlier helps the world’s most innovative companies improve their AI models by providing human feedback. Are you an experienced software engineer who would like to lend your coding expertise to train AI models? We partner with organizations to train AI large language models, helping cutting-edge generative AI models write better code. Projects typically include discrete, highly variable problems that involve engaging with these models as they learn to code. There is no requirement for previous AI experience. About The Opportunity Outlier is looking for talented coders to help train generative artificial intelligence models This freelance opportunity is remote and hours are flexible, so you can work whenever is best for you You may contribute your expertise by… Crafting and answering questions related to computer science in order to help train AI models Evaluating and ranking code generated by AI models Examples Of Desirable Expertise Currently enrolled in or completed a bachelor's degree or higher in computer science at a selective institution Proficiency working with one or more of the the following languages: Java, Python, JavaScript / TypeScript, C++, Swift, and Verilog Excellent attention to detail, including grammar, punctuation, and style guidelines Payment Currently, pay rates for core project work by coding experts range from USD $12.50 to $50 per hour. Rates vary based on expertise, skills assessment, location, project need, and other factors. For example, higher rates may be offered to PhDs. For non-core work, such as during initial project onboarding or project overtime phases, lower rates may apply. Certain projects offer incentive payments. Please review the payment terms for each project.